Kanban has emerged as a popular project management framework known for its simplicity and flexibility. At its core, Kanban is a visual system that helps teams manage the flow of work. By using a board with columns, each representing a different stage of the workflow, Kanban provides a clear picture of progress and potential bottlenecks.
- Members can quickly identify tasks that are delayed.
- This, Kanban promotes communication within the team, leading improved efficiency and effectiveness.
- In addition, Kanban's emphasis on continuous improvement encourages a culture of learning, allowing teams to improve their workflow.
